Improve Wired Headphone Audio From A Nintendo Switch?

Like most people this time of year, I've been traveling to visit family. Also like most, a set of headphones is a must for long plane rides. My current phone is the Razer Phone, which also means carrying Razer's USB-C dongle which contains a 24 bit THX certified DAC. Sure, that may not mean much since Razer owns THX, but keep reading. As of firmware 5.0, the Nintendo Switch could pass audio via its USB-C port. Most people have used this for wireless USB headsets. Now what happens when you're aren't paying attention and just plug your headphones with dongle attached to the Switch's USB-C port? Pure audio bliss, that's what. Deeper, more vibrant audio. I just tried with Ys VIII and the recently released R-type and wow. Switching between the Razer dongle and the Switch's headphone jack was night and day. If you use a wired headset, even a cheap set, this will most definitely improve your audio quality. If interested, the dongle can be found here for $19.99...

Akiba's Trip To Have Dual Audio And More!

Image
For a game like this, the norm seems to be just to translate the text and leave the audio alone. XSEED Games decided to toss that idea to the trash as Akiba's Trip will now have full English and Japanese audio! Also, "Strip Portraits" will no longer be limited to the female characters as the prominent male characters will also have "Strip Portraits." Read the full press release after the break
